Learn how to make crispy, fluffy hash browns that taste just like they do at restaurants, along with a vibrant Swiss chard salad. This unique method of pounding and mashing potatoes achieves the perfect texture. Enjoy this exquisite recipe for a professional taste at home.
Ingredients
Main Ingredients (2 Hash Browns)
- 1 Potato
- Potato Starch 1/2 tbsp
- Swiss Chard (to taste)
- 2 slices Bacon
Seasonings
- Salt (to taste)
- Olive Oil or Vegetable Oil (to taste)
- Ketchup (to taste)
- Olive Oil 1 tbsp
- Coarse Black Pepper (to taste)
- Grated Cheese (to taste)
Steps
- Cut 1 Potato into julienne strips, then into batons.
- Place the cut potatoes into a ziplock bag and seal it tightly.
- Pound the potatoes in the bag to mash them. [The Secret Here!] Mash them until there are fine crumbs and some chunkier pieces remaining. This creates a crispy yet chewy texture.
- Add a pinch of salt to the mashed potatoes and mix. [The Secret Here!] Mimic the saltiness of popular fast-food hash browns and season generously.
- Add 1/2 tbsp Potato Starch and mix thoroughly by kneading to ensure it binds well.
- Heat a generous amount of Olive Oil or Vegetable Oil in a frying pan over medium heat.
- Shape the mixed potatoes into your desired shape (oval here) and place them in the hot pan. Fry both sides until golden brown. [The Secret Here!] The starch will bind them firmly, so you don't need to worry about them falling apart. The edges turning golden is your cue to flip.
- Serve the cooked hash browns on a plate and add Ketchup (to taste) if desired.
- Wash Swiss Chard (to taste), drain the water, and arrange on a plate.
- Heat 1 tbsp Olive Oil in a frying pan and fry 2 slices of Bacon until crispy.
- Drizzle the hot bacon and its rendered fat over the Swiss Chard.
- Season the salad with a pinch of salt, coarse black pepper (to taste), and grated cheese (to taste).
